💰 Зарплаты в IT в первой половине 2024: по городам, специализациям, языкам и компаниям → подробнее

C++/ C Developer

Требования

Разработка ПОC++C

Местоположение и тип занятости

Москва

Компания

ТОП-3 международная компания в области IT-безопасности, один из лучших работодателей России

Описание вакансии

Условия работы

«Лаборатория Касперского» работает над созданием продуктов на базе операционной системы KasperskyOS (http://os.kaspersky.ru). Одно из новых направлений — доверенная среда исполнения кода для архитектур ARMv8-A на основе технологий ARM TrustZone/TEE (Trusted Execution Environment) с целью создания безопасных аппаратных платформ.

И мы ищем в команду Разработчика C/C++

Какие задачи вы будете решать в нашей команде:

  • Разработка программного обеспечения для KasperskyOS (в том числе сервисов и драйверов аппаратных компонентов);
  • Оптимизация кода для максимального использования возможностей конкретного оборудования;
  • Работа с «железом» :)

Чтобы быть успешным в данной роли понадобится:

  • Отличное знание C/C++;
  • Опыт разработки для встраиваемых систем на базе Linux, владение инструментарием (GCC, Make/CMake, GDB);
  • Технический английский – свободное чтение документации.

Будет плюсом:

  • Опыт разработки под разные архитектуры процессоров (x86, ARM, MIPS);
  • Знание KasperskyOS;
  • Знакомство с технологиями TrustZone/TEE;
  • Знакомство со стандартом POSIX.